基于网络通信技术的赛事信息综合处理系统技术方案

技术编号:15822704 阅读:28 留言:0更新日期:2017-07-15 04:54
本发明专利技术公开了基于网络通信技术的赛事信息综合处理系统,赛事信息采集模块采集所有单项的竞赛实时成绩数据并生成JSON文件,根据FTP通信协议通过数据交换中心上传至赛事信息处理模块;所述赛事信息处理模块收到竞赛信息数据文件后将竞赛实时成绩数据文件存入文件服务器,并将与综合数据相关的JSON文件解析为数据对象写入数据库服务器中,所述赛事信息发布模块通过HTTP协议向文件服务器获取竞赛实时成绩数据,向数据库服务器获取综合数据,并把获取的信息按照业务规则进行展示。本发明专利技术实现了对综合性体育赛事所有单项竞赛信息的收集、存储、统计和分发功能,实现了数据采集和分发的准确性,简化了处理系统结构,提高了处理效率。

【技术实现步骤摘要】
基于网络通信技术的赛事信息综合处理系统
本专利技术涉及赛事信息综合处理系统,特别涉及基于网络通信技术的赛事信息综合处理系统。
技术介绍
随着经济的发展和社会的推动,大型综合体育赛事已经成为一项重要的社会活动。早期的综合性体育赛事作为单纯的体育竞技,采用较为简单传统的计时记分方式,耗费较多时间和人力,精确度和效率都比较低,人们希望能有一套高效的系统,一方面可以省去人工计量和人工计算等步骤,提高精确度,另一方面可以以高效的方式完成工作,加快比赛节奏,使比赛节奏更加紧凑,更具观赏性。由于以上需求的出现,同时伴随着全球信息化程度日渐增长,综合性体育赛事体系的日渐成熟和完善,一套完整的综合性体育赛事信息综合处理系统应运而生,为综合性体育赛事提供精确高效的服务。赛事信息综合处理系统发展至今,仍然存在着一些问题,虽然计算机技术和网络通信技术的发展使得系统日趋完善,但仍旧有新的问题暴露出来,解决这些问题才能使得赛事信息综合处理系统更好的服务于大型综合体育赛事,是推进系统发展的关键步骤。主要存在的问题有以下几个方面:第一,同时处理多个用户的数据请求时容易发生阻塞的情况;第二,由于采取的数据存储和传输格本文档来自技高网...
基于网络通信技术的赛事信息综合处理系统

【技术保护点】
基于网络通信技术的赛事信息综合处理系统,其特征在于,包括赛事信息采集模块、赛事信息处理模块和赛事信息发布模块,其中,所述赛事信息采集模块采集所有单项的竞赛实时成绩数据并生成JSON文件,根据FTP通信协议通过数据交换中心上传至赛事信息处理模块;所述赛事信息处理模块收到竞赛信息数据文件后将竞赛实时成绩数据文件存入文件服务器,并将与综合数据相关的JSON文件解析为数据对象写入赛事信息处理模块的数据库服务器中,方便其他模块对综合数据进行查询;所述赛事信息发布模块通过HTTP协议向赛事信息处理模块的文件服务器请求并获取竞赛实时成绩数据,向数据库服务器获取综合数据,并把获取的信息按照业务规则进行展示。

【技术特征摘要】
1.基于网络通信技术的赛事信息综合处理系统,其特征在于,包括赛事信息采集模块、赛事信息处理模块和赛事信息发布模块,其中,所述赛事信息采集模块采集所有单项的竞赛实时成绩数据并生成JSON文件,根据FTP通信协议通过数据交换中心上传至赛事信息处理模块;所述赛事信息处理模块收到竞赛信息数据文件后将竞赛实时成绩数据文件存入文件服务器,并将与综合数据相关的JSON文件解析为数据对象写入赛事信息处理模块的数据库服务器中,方便其他模块对综合数据进行查询;所述赛事信息发布模块通过HTTP协议向赛事信息处理模块的文件服务器请求并获取竞赛实时成绩数据,向数据库服务器获取综合数据,并把获取的信息按照业务规则进行展示。2.根据权利要求1所述的基于网络通信技术的赛事信息综合处理系统,其特征在于,所述赛事信息采集模块以JSON文件作为数据存储传输的媒介,通过现场以太网将各个竞赛单项实时成绩序列化为JSON字符串,通过数据校验机制进行校验后写入JSON文件,所述JSON文件通过数据交换中心上传至赛事信息处理模块的文件服务器。3.根据权利要求2所述的基于网络通信技术的赛事信息综合处理系统,其特征在于,所述赛事信息处理模块包括信息存储子模块和信息统计子模块,其中,所述信息存储子模块包括文件服务器,用于存储接收的竞赛实时数据,当赛事信息发布模块对竞赛实时数据发起查询时,可直接从文件服务器中将对应的JSON文件下载至客户端进行解析;所述信息统计子模块包括数据库服务器,用于存储综合业务数据,从文件服务器中读取JSON文件,将数据写入数据库服务器中,并统计综合奖牌和积分信息写入数据库服务器中,当赛事信息发布模块发起查询时,将查询SQL语句实例传送至数据库服务器进行查询并将返回的数据生成JSON字符串,发送至赛事信息发布模块进行信息发布展示。4.根据权利要求1所述的基于网络通信技术的赛事信息综合处理系统,其特征在于,所述赛事信息发布模块基于B/S架构,采用jQuery框架,通过异步的AJAX方法从赛事信息处理模块获取信息发布页面所需数据,并使用统一的数据结构将信息发布至官网、客户端和第三方网站。5.根据权利要求2所述的基于网络通信技术的赛事信息综合处理系统,其特征在于,所述数据校验机制为在.NET平台下使用JSONSCHEMA对JSON文件的进行校验,将预先创建的小项JSONSCHEMA存储在该项目赛事信息采集模块的现场成绩处理端,且每个小项按照该小项需要上传的JSON文...

【专利技术属性】
技术研发人员:丁波王萍牟艳陈鹏张九博刘志丰王晓敏申红伟高振兴徐萌萌
申请(专利权)人:河海大学常州校区
类型:发明
国别省市:江苏,32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1